Bug#366620: initramfs-tools: 2.6.16-1-powerpc fails to mount rootfs, 2.6.15-1-powerpc works



Package: initramfs-tools
Version: 0.60
Severity: important


This might be a bug in the kernel or udev or something else, but
failure to mount root fs smells like an initrd problem to me.

Bootloader: quik, with ramdisk_size 8192 (even tested 16384, with no luck)
Rootfs: ext2 on ide
Module for the harddisk:
lsmod says "ide_disk" on 2.6.15, but the
module is called ide-disk.ko and that module is present in booth the
working initrd.img (2.6.15-1-powerpc) and the non-working
(2.6.16-1-powerpc). ext2.ko also present in the initrd in booth
initrds.

Debuging is problematic on this box since I don't have a working
serial console, nor can I interact with the bootloader via the
keyboard, so If a kernel+initrd doesn't work, I have to boot from the
woody installation floppy-disks and rescue from a shell in the
installation program.
